Gemini 2.5 Pro Computer Use Preview vs Phi 3.5 Mini Instruct

Gemini 2.5 Pro Computer Use Preview (2025) and Phi 3.5 Mini Instruct (2024) are compact production models from Google DeepMind and Microsoft Research. Gemini 2.5 Pro Computer Use Preview ships a 1.048576M-token context window, while Phi 3.5 Mini Instruct ships a 128K-token context window. On pricing, Phi 3.5 Mini Instruct costs $0.9/1M input tokens versus $1.25/1M for the alternative. This comparison covers specs, pricing, capabilities, benchmarks, provider availability, and production fit.

Gemini 2.5 Pro Computer Use Preview fits 8x more tokens; pick it for long-context work and Phi 3.5 Mini Instruct for tighter calls.

FAQ

Which has a larger context window, Gemini 2.5 Pro Computer Use Preview or Phi 3.5 Mini Instruct?

Gemini 2.5 Pro Computer Use Preview supports 1.048576M tokens, while Phi 3.5 Mini Instruct supports 128K tokens. That gap matters most for long documents, large codebases, retrieval-heavy agents, and conversations where earlier context must remain visible.

Which is cheaper, Gemini 2.5 Pro Computer Use Preview or Phi 3.5 Mini Instruct?

Phi 3.5 Mini Instruct is cheaper on tracked token pricing. Gemini 2.5 Pro Computer Use Preview costs $1.25/1M input and $10/1M output tokens. Phi 3.5 Mini Instruct costs $0.9/1M input and $0.9/1M output tokens. Provider discounts or batch pricing can still change the final bill.

Is Gemini 2.5 Pro Computer Use Preview or Phi 3.5 Mini Instruct open source?

Gemini 2.5 Pro Computer Use Preview is listed under Proprietary. Phi 3.5 Mini Instruct is listed under MIT. License labels affect whether you can self-host, redistribute weights, or rely only on hosted APIs, so confirm the upstream license before deployment.

Where can I run Gemini 2.5 Pro Computer Use Preview and Phi 3.5 Mini Instruct?

Gemini 2.5 Pro Computer Use Preview is available on Google AI Studio. Phi 3.5 Mini Instruct is available on Fireworks AI and NVIDIA NIM. Provider coverage can affect latency, region availability, compliance posture, and fallback options.
